The Department of Physics is one of the biggest departments within the Faculty of Science and supports a broad range of basic research in experimental and theoretical physics. It has about 250 employees of which 95 are PhD students. Many have been internationally recruited. The Department is part of the AlbaNova University Center, which apart from the Department of Physics houses the Department of Astronomy, the Physics Departments at the Royal Institute of Technology (KTH), and the Nordic Institute for Theoretical Physics (Nordita).

Project description
We are searching for individuals to conduct original research on developing scalable gravitational wave data analysis methods for the efficient scientific exploitation of populations of compact object mergers in the LIGO A+ era. The candidate will work with Hiranya Peiris, Daniel Mortlock and external collaborator Samaya Nissanke (UvA). Up to two positions are available, funded by the Swedish Research Council and the Knut and Alice Wallenberg Foundation. Applicants will be members of the European Research Council Advanced Grant CosmicExplorer project, led by Hiranya Peiris. They will also benefit from a vibrant local environment in multimessenger astrophysics and cosmology; faculty with related interests include Ariel Goobar, Stephan Rosswog, Jesper Sollerman and Anders Jerkstrand.

The candidates will be part of the Oskar Klein Centre for Cosmoparticle Physics (www.okc.albanova.se/ ) in Stockholm, a rich scientific environment that comprises more than a hundred researchers working in both theory and experiment in the fields of astronomy, astrophysics and particle physics at both Stockholm University and the Royal Institute for Technology. The OKC hosts a vibrant research program on dark matter, dark energy, transient and multimessenger astrophysics, galaxy evolution, structure formation, and related particle physics questions. Postdoctoral associates are also welcome to participate in Scientific Programs at Nordita, the Nordic Institute for Theoretical Physics, which bring together groups of leading experts to work on specific topics for extended periods.

Main responsibilities
The positions involve original research in gravitational wave and multimessenger astrophysics and cosmology, broadly related to testing fundamental physics in the LIGO A+era. Responsibilities will include the development and application of advanced statistical inference and machine learning techniques for the analysis of compact object merger populations, taking into account selection effects and systematic biases. A particular focus relates to the use of machine learning techniques for accelerating forward-modelling and density estimation. There will be opportunities to engage with the design of optical follow-up strategies with LSST and other facilities and derive the relevant EM selection functions.
